Re: What was the fastest factory F-body made?

Originally Posted by chamealeondroptopZ
Why would a no option Z28 be faster than an 02 Firehawk?The Firehawk came with the SLP exhaust,Ram Air,and came with the SLP airlid and was rated at 345 hp.Plus it had fat 275/40/17 tires.Granted,the Z may have been a little lighter but its rated 35 hp less.
HP rating doesn't mean squat. A 01/02 LS1 (be it Z28, WS6, whatever) is going to put down 300-320 RWHP. A Firehawk will do little to no better - regardless of rating. A no-option Z is the lightest of all F-bodys. With the same HP, it will outrun the others.

89 TTAs were fast, but in 100% unaltered, bone stock condition, I never, ever heard of one running 12.89 @ 109 mph.

Re: What was the fastest factory F-body made?

Originally Posted by MightyMouse98Z
On the sheet Bob posted, it says 13.2@107
I have that issue of Car and Driver your referring to.They got 0-60 in 4.6 seconds as well.With 390ftlbs of torque,it probably roasted the tires all the way through 2nd.They also got a 13.9 out of a 98 6spd Trans Am,so go figure.There were also 3 92 Firehawks with 375 hp aluminum race engines.Those cars i'm sure would hand an LT4 Hawk or LS1 car its a$$.BTW,I'm still not convinced a 1LE Z is faster than a Firehawk,SLP made them to be the fastest F-bodys and you could get them with a torsen rear,short throw shifter,high flow airlid,as well as the standard ram air,fatter tires ,and catback exhaust.I dont think,the weight difference on a stripper(tops 150lbs)would make up that difference,but it would be close.
